Eastern Qualifier #1 on the Chowan River Kicks Off 2025 Season
The 2025 season is officially underway! The first Eastern Series Qualifying Event was held this past weekend on the Chowan River, and it didn’t disappoint. Anglers were met with tough conditions, but the weights at the top proved that quality fish were still biting.
Walt Goff and Phillip Gibson took the top spot with an impressive 25.12 lbs., anchored by the tournament’s Big Fish — a 7.8 lb. giant. Their winning bag earned them $1,270, and they also claimed the Big Fish payout of $210.
In second place, Travis Badgett and Ricky Mize brought in 20.10 lbs., with a 5.39 lb. kicker, and rounding out the top three were Adam Haithcock and Mike Cox with 15.16 lbs.
The top 20 anglers from this event have punched their ticket to the 2025 North Carolina BASS Nation State Championship, which will be announced at the final Western Trail event.
